Why Strip Centers Reward Direct Sourcing
Strip center deals often look ordinary until you understand the ownership and the tenant story. A property with local ownership, below-market rents, tired curb appeal, or fragmented management can be a strong target before it ever gets packaged for sale.
The wrong approach is browsing listings and reacting to whatever reaches your inbox. The better approach is building a list of owners in the exact corridors where your tenant and repositioning thesis works.

The Workflow
Pick the corridor. Define the center profile. Pull owners. Tag likely operational upside. Then reach out with a specific reason: tenancy, age, location, ownership duration, or portfolio fit.
